## Eligibility & scope

Free trial of Tier-1 Data resources for Flemish university/SOC/public knowledge institution researchers. Apply by email to data@vscentrum.be and local VSC coordinator. No set deadlines.

## Summary

The Tier-1 Data Starting Grant is a rolling trial offering free access to Tier-1 high-performance computing resources for researchers at Flemish universities, research centres, and public knowledge institutions. Applications are assessed on a rolling basis with no set deadlines; interested researchers should contact data@vscentrum.be and their local VSC coordinator to apply. This is a resource-access grant rather than a funding programme, designed to lower barriers to HPC adoption for early-stage computational research.

## Tips for applicants

- Contact both data@vscentrum.be and your local VSC coordinator in parallel to ensure your institution is registered and your request reaches the right decision-maker.
- Clarify your computational scope and expected resource use upfront; the Tier-1 Data team needs this to allocate trial time appropriately.
- Use this trial to pilot your research on HPC; successful projects can then apply for longer-term allocations through the standard VSC channels.
